恩山无线论坛

 找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
查看: 6703|回复: 19

原生IPV6怎么整

[复制链接]
发表于 2018-9-14 12:42 | 显示全部楼层 |阅读模式
华为光猫自带路由配置文件自动下发PPPOE密码不知,老毛子为二级路由开了DHCPv6路由器WAN口可以拿到V6地址并可以PING通外网V6IP,LAN端电脑等设备可以获取外网V6IP,但是不能访问,如果用modprobe ip6table_mangle  ,  ebtables -t broute -A BROUTING -p ! ipv6 -j DROP -i eth3  ,  brctl addif br0 eth3 这三句后,LAN口端全部正常了,路由器WAN口也就没有V6地址了,怎么两全齐美?6relayd据说很不稳定,openwrt有odhcpd,老毛子怎么搞?
我的恩山、我的无线 The best wifi forum is right here.
发表于 2018-9-15 10:35 来自手机 | 显示全部楼层
sysctl -w net.ipv6.conf.br0.accept_ra=2

点评

修改这个参数好像也不管用,具体点怎么整?  详情 回复 发表于 2018-9-16 15:04
我的恩山、我的无线 The best wifi forum is right here.
发表于 2018-9-15 18:47 | 显示全部楼层
其实就是一个防火墙的问题,如果是openwrt的话把防火墙桥接到lan就可以了,最近在玩openwrt没有用老帽子了
我的恩山、我的无线 The best wifi forum is right here.
 楼主| 发表于 2018-9-16 15:04 | 显示全部楼层
LGA1150 发表于 2018-9-15 10:35
sysctl -w net.ipv6.conf.br0.accept_ra=2

修改这个参数好像也不管用,具体点怎么整?

点评

这条命令是在 ebtables 桥接的基础上运行的,目的是让路由器 LAN 获取 IPv6 地址  详情 回复 发表于 2018-9-17 02:09
我的恩山、我的无线 The best wifi forum is right here.
发表于 2018-9-17 02:09 | 显示全部楼层
stock169 发表于 2018-9-16 15:04
修改这个参数好像也不管用,具体点怎么整?

这条命令是在 ebtables 桥接的基础上运行的,目的是让路由器 LAN 获取 IPv6 地址

点评

实测ebtables桥接了LAN口下所有设备都能拿到V6IP,但是路由器的本身无论LAN还是WAN都拿不到V6地址的,改了这个参数也是不行的  详情 回复 发表于 2018-9-17 11:09
我的恩山、我的无线 The best wifi forum is right here.
 楼主| 发表于 2018-9-17 11:09 | 显示全部楼层
LGA1150 发表于 2018-9-17 02:09
这条命令是在 ebtables 桥接的基础上运行的,目的是让路由器 LAN 获取 IPv6 地址

实测ebtables桥接了LAN口下所有设备都能拿到V6IP,但是路由器的本身无论LAN还是WAN都拿不到V6地址的,改了这个参数也是不行的

点评

可能是路由器 IPv6 关闭的情况下,IPv6 是默认禁用的,试试依次执行以下的命令 sysctl -w net.ipv6.conf.all.disable_ipv6=0 sysctl -w net.ipv6.conf.br0.disable_ipv6=0 sysctl -w net.ipv6.conf.br0.accept_ra  详情 回复 发表于 2018-9-17 19:57
我的恩山、我的无线 The best wifi forum is right here.
发表于 2018-9-17 19:57 来自手机 | 显示全部楼层
stock169 发表于 2018-9-17 11:09
实测ebtables桥接了LAN口下所有设备都能拿到V6IP,但是路由器的本身无论LAN还是WAN都拿不到V6地址的,改 ...

可能是路由器 IPv6 关闭的情况下,IPv6 是默认禁用的,试试依次执行以下的命令
sysctl -w net.ipv6.conf.all.disable_ipv6=0
sysctl -w net.ipv6.conf.br0.disable_ipv6=0
sysctl -w net.ipv6.conf.br0.accept_ra=2
sysctl -w net.ipv6.conf.br0.accept_ra_defrtr=1

点评

桥接了路由IPV6DHCP是要关闭的,我试过开了也没用拿不到地址的,这些配置参数也都试过路由器lan口wan口都获取不到地址的,我感觉桥接了就成了个两层交换机了  详情 回复 发表于 2018-9-18 10:49
我的恩山、我的无线 The best wifi forum is right here.
 楼主| 发表于 2018-9-18 10:49 | 显示全部楼层
LGA1150 发表于 2018-9-17 19:57
可能是路由器 IPv6 关闭的情况下,IPv6 是默认禁用的,试试依次执行以下的命令
sysctl -w net.ipv6.conf ...

桥接了路由IPV6DHCP是要关闭的,我试过开了也没用拿不到地址的,这些配置参数也都试过路由器lan口wan口都获取不到地址的,我感觉桥接了就成了个两层交换机了

点评

你确认你那边分配 IPv6 的方式是 DHCPv6 而不是 SLAAC?电脑获取到的 IPv6 后 64 位是随机的吗? sysctl net.ipv6.conf.br0 输出结果给我看看  详情 回复 发表于 2018-9-18 12:18
我的恩山、我的无线 The best wifi forum is right here.
发表于 2018-9-18 12:18 | 显示全部楼层
stock169 发表于 2018-9-18 10:49
桥接了路由IPV6DHCP是要关闭的,我试过开了也没用拿不到地址的,这些配置参数也都试过路由器lan口wan口都 ...

你确认你那边分配 IPv6 的方式是 DHCPv6 而不是 SLAAC?电脑获取到的 IPv6 后 64 位是随机的吗?
sysctl net.ipv6.conf.br0 输出结果给我看看

点评

没错是DHCPv6,不管电脑还是路由器开了DHCP获取地址就可以拿到公网V6还就是/64的,只是这老毛子lan口下电脑拿到地址是不通的,6relayd我也试了开了就通但是很不稳定没有V6数据通信就断掉实在蛋疼,主要想路由能拿个v  详情 回复 发表于 2018-9-18 13:01
我的恩山、我的无线 The best wifi forum is right here.
 楼主| 发表于 2018-9-18 13:01 | 显示全部楼层
LGA1150 发表于 2018-9-18 12:18
你确认你那边分配 IPv6 的方式是 DHCPv6 而不是 SLAAC?电脑获取到的 IPv6 后 64 位是随机的吗?
sysctl ...

没错是DHCPv6,不管电脑还是路由器开了DHCP获取地址就可以拿到公网V6还就是/64的,只是这老毛子lan口下电脑拿到地址是不通的,6relayd我也试了开了就通但是很不稳定没有V6数据通信就断掉实在蛋疼,主要想路由能拿个v6地址可以解决一些外网访问问题,NAT模式也试了不知啥鬼问题开始很好,后来重启后发现WIFI下所有设备访问V6地址巨慢,有线部分似乎又是正常的V6测速也能过200M实在晕死了。

点评

/64 的显然是 SLAAC,你都不知道 IPv6 地址分配是怎么样的,有哪些方式  详情 回复 发表于 2018-9-18 14:36
我的恩山、我的无线 The best wifi forum is right here.
发表于 2018-9-18 14:36 来自手机 | 显示全部楼层
stock169 发表于 2018-9-18 13:01
没错是DHCPv6,不管电脑还是路由器开了DHCP获取地址就可以拿到公网V6还就是/64的,只是这老毛子lan口下电 ...

/64 的显然是 SLAAC,你都不知道 IPv6 地址分配是怎么样的,有哪些方式

点评

老毛子里DHCP RA 和 IA-NA 试过都能拿到地址的  详情 回复 发表于 2018-9-18 14:56
我的恩山、我的无线 The best wifi forum is right here.
 楼主| 发表于 2018-9-18 14:56 | 显示全部楼层
LGA1150 发表于 2018-9-18 14:36
/64 的显然是 SLAAC,你都不知道 IPv6 地址分配是怎么样的,有哪些方式

老毛子里DHCP RA 和 IA-NA 试过都能拿到地址的

点评

打住,把 sysctl 结果发给我看看  详情 回复 发表于 2018-9-18 15:07
我的恩山、我的无线 The best wifi forum is right here.
发表于 2018-9-18 15:07 来自手机 | 显示全部楼层
stock169 发表于 2018-9-18 14:56
老毛子里DHCP RA 和 IA-NA 试过都能拿到地址的

打住,把 sysctl 结果发给我看看

点评

老哥求救,我也是用那三条命令的方法,路由器本身分配不到ipv6 wan和lan 这个是sysctl结果 net.ipv6.conf.br0.accept_dad = 1 net.ipv6.conf.br0.accept_ra = 2 net.ipv6.conf.br0.accept_ra_defrtr = 1 net.ip  详情 回复 发表于 2019-9-4 22:25
全部参数都导出给你研究吧,目前还是那个三条命令的桥接模式。  详情 回复 发表于 2018-9-18 15:17
我的恩山、我的无线 The best wifi forum is right here.
 楼主| 发表于 2018-9-18 15:17 | 显示全部楼层
LGA1150 发表于 2018-9-18 15:07
打住,把 sysctl 结果发给我看看


全部参数都导出给你研究吧,目前还是那个三条命令的桥接模式。

sysctl.zip

9.71 KB, 下载次数: 12

点评

另外还有 ip6tables 防火墙设置,我觉得是这个的问题 以下命令是允许所有 IPv6 ip6tables -F ip6tables -X ip6tables -P INPUT ACCEPT ip6tables -P OUTPUT ACCEPT ip6tables -P FORWARD ACCEPT  详情 回复 发表于 2018-9-18 15:32
我的恩山、我的无线 The best wifi forum is right here.
发表于 2018-9-18 15:32 来自手机 | 显示全部楼层
stock169 发表于 2018-9-18 15:17
全部参数都导出给你研究吧,目前还是那个三条命令的桥接模式。

另外还有 ip6tables 防火墙设置,我觉得是这个的问题

以下命令是允许所有 IPv6
ip6tables -F
ip6tables -X
ip6tables -P INPUT ACCEPT
ip6tables -P OUTPUT ACCEPT
ip6tables -P FORWARD ACCEPT

点评

你好,问下这个防火墙设置需要在路由器上怎么操作,这段文字输在哪里啊?  详情 回复 发表于 2019-3-3 03:25
我的恩山、我的无线 The best wifi forum is right here.
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|手机版|小黑屋|Archiver|恩山无线论坛(常州市恩山计算机开发有限公司版权所有) ( 苏ICP备05084872号 )

GMT+8, 2019-9-22 18:09

Powered by Discuz! X3.4

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表